Reliably feeding small and micro parts is one of the biggest challenges in automation. It is not enough to simply move parts—they must be separated, correctly aligned, and made available at exactly the right moment. It becomes even more complex when a system has to process not only individual parts, but also changing parts. This is exactly where the flexfeeder comes in.
A classic vibration or shaking system quickly reaches its limits: either it is designed for a specific part, or the conversion costs when changing parts are so high that flexibility in everyday use is lost. The approach to developing the flexfeeder was therefore different from the outset: it was developed as a modular complete system that specializes in flexible feeding and can handle a wide variety of parts.
Camera – the systems eye
At the heart of parts recognition is the software in conjunction with the integrated industrial camera. It analyzes in real time how the parts are positioned on the feed platform, records their exact position, and passes this information on to the robot. With the help of intelligent image processing algorithms, defective parts are ejected and unsuitably positioned parts are detected and separated again. This ensures that only fault-free parts are picked up and processed further – precisely, quickly, and reliably.
Bunker – constant supply for the feeder
To ensure that the process runs smoothly, a controlled and continuous supply of parts is required. This is provided by the bunker, which automatically supplies the flexfeeder with components. This ensures that sufficient material is available at all times without the need for an operator to constantly refill it. This increases the autonomy of the system and enables longer running times without intervention.
